During acceleration is when you're testing the torque of your motor the most. So, if it's got good hole shot, but just can't maintain the speed, I think you're looking at something besides a compression/performance issue.
Best bet is to take a reading and post the results. 100psi or better and you're certainly looking good. 60 or less and you've got some problems. The middle ground may or may not indicate issues depending on gauges, particular motors, and measurement procedures.
Any variation of 10% between cylinders indicates something as well.
